The Siena Learning Center is a non-profit, non-denominational educational outreach ministry of the Dominican Sisters of Peace. The Center offers English as a Second Language to Adult Learners in the Greater New Britain area of Connecticut, assisting in career opportunities and earning American citizenship.

What Do We Do?

The Siena Learning Center offers a holistic approach to literacy for underserved adult learners, with a special emphasis on English as a Second Language (ESL).
